LG pediatric is seeking a Back office Medical Assistant (Full-time, 40 hours/week with ) to join our team in our Los Gatos location. We have been in south bay for more than 3 decades. We provide high quality medical care with a personal touch. This special candidate will present with at least 1 year of medical office experience in a busy medical office. The ideal candidate should be warm and positive in nature, people oriented and have a calm and reassuring manner, good organization skills and multitasker, comfortable working and communicating with children and their parents. Works as a team member to create a warm and nurturing medical home for children from newborn to teens.

Daily duties and responsibility include but are not limited to following:

Answer phones as needed and triage appropriately
Room in the patients, check vitals ,
Identify immunization records, prep records before physical exams
Administer vaccines to children ranged from newborn through teens effectively and document vaccine records.
Check vaccine stock and medical supplies and order as needed
Perform routine office tests, UA, Strep , Rapid flu, vision, hearing screen
Process referrals and arrange specialist or test appointments
Follow up with patients messages and emails. Relay test or x-ray results and present those results to physicians
Assist front desk with phone calls and filings
Provide patient education.
Stock rooms and prep rooms for visits
Assistant physician for procedures and treatments
